Least Common Multiple of 87282 and 87286 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 87282 and 87286,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(87282,87286) = 2
LCM(87282,87286) = ( 87282 × 87286) / 2
LCM(87282,87286) = 7618496652 / 2
LCM(87282,87286) = 3809248326
